One thing that immediately stands out is the potential financial implications for both clubs. Burton is a versatile player, and his value is likely to be high. With a potential price tag of over $1 million, the Eels could be looking at a significant investment. But is it a logical move? From my perspective, the Eels have a strong spine, with three of their four spine positions already in place. This means they have the foundation for a competitive team, and adding Burton could be the missing piece. What makes this particularly fascinating is the potential impact on the Bulldogs. With Burton's departure, they may need to reevaluate their strategy and find a new centre to partner with Jesse McLean. This could be a turning point for the club, and it raises a deeper question: how will they adapt to this change? The Eels, on the other hand, have a clear vision for their team. They are looking for a five-eighth to partner with Mitch Moses, and Burton could be the ideal fit. Moses wants to run the team, and Burton's simple game plan and great kicking skills could complement his style perfectly. This is a strategic move, and it could pay off handsomely for the Eels. However, there are some challenges to consider. The Bulldogs may not be willing to part with Burton for a centre, and the Eels will need to offer a competitive salary to secure his services.
